The Waldhaus is a barbecue hut in the Baumholder city forest. The forest house in the Baumholder city forest can be rented from the city (Tel: 06783 - 98 11 40). There is water and electricity and the possibility to grill. Indoor and outdoor seating invite you to linger and rest. The rest area is located on the "Bärenbachpfad" dream loop. During guided hikes with food, you can rest and eat there. (Source: https://www.outdooractive.com)

The town of Baumholder has two huts with barbecue areas in the "Gärtel": the "Waldhaus" and the "Nöhringhütte". Both cabins are equipped with toilets. The forest house also has a generator that is used for power supply, lighting and toilet flushing. The huts can be rented by the day from the city office.

Are there any historical sites or landmarks near the huts around Ruschberg?

Yes, the Kaiserallee on the Nahekopf is a notable historical site near Ruschberg. It features steles presenting Roman emperors who ruled during the time the Nahekopf was settled, along with original sandstones found during excavations. This site offers insights into the region's Roman past.
